Honestly, my gut says that they're going to go with this Bottega Side Chair (below). They like that it's square and masculine, the leather is easier to clean than upholstery, and they're much more comfortable than they look. When you lean back in the chair, the back is flexible and moves with you, which makes a huge difference. It pretty much fits the bill.
